Jason Momoa to Star in Revenge Action Film ‘Sweet Girl’ at Netflix

Jason Momoa is a father out for revenge in a new action film called “Sweet Girl” for Netflix, the streamer announced Monday. Momoa will star in the film from director Brian Andrew Mendoza, who is making his feature directorial debut. Mendoza was the cinematographer on Momoa’s film 2018 film “Braven” and executive producer on his series “Frontier.” In “Sweet Girl,” Momoa will play a devastated husband who vows to bring justice to the people responsible for his wife’s death while protecting the only family he has left, his daughter. Brad Peyton and Jeff Fierson are producing for ASAP Entertainment along with Momoa and Mendoza. Martin Kistler is serving as executive producer. “Sweet Girl” marks the third feature project in an ongoing partnership between Netflix and ASAP Entertainment.
